Electrical systems are an integral part of our everyday lives, powering our homes, offices, and various appliances. However, these systems are not immune to faults and malfunctions, and one of the most common issues that can arise is an electrical short. An electrical short refers to a situation where the current flowing through a circuit deviates from its intended path, resulting in a sudden surge of electrical energy. This deviation can lead to serious consequences such as overheating, sparking, and even fires. Therefore, understanding the causes of electrical shorts and knowing how to resolve them safely is of utmost importance. Notes on troubleshooting electrical problems
Bare wires used outside the house are about 0.25m apart. The electrical connections to the equipment must be firm, not open, not touching each other. Use insulating tape to seal the connection.
When installing, the conductor cross-section must be selected in accordance with the load current. Avoid using many electrical equipment with a large capacity that exceeds the carrying capacity of the conductor.
Check the temperature of the power consuming equipment regularly, check the sheath, conductor insulation. If there is an overload, it should be fixed immediately.
Use a fuse and use aptomat for the main power line. When buying, you need to choose quality plug and socket devices, which are compatible with each other and well insulated.

In conclusion, an electrical short is a common issue that occurs when an unintended pathway is created in an electrical circuit. It can be caused by various factors such as damaged insulation, loose connections, overloaded circuits, or faulty appliances. Electrical shorts can result in power outages, circuit damages, and even fires, posing significant risks to both property and human safety.
To safely fix an electrical short, it is crucial to identify the root cause first. This can be done by inspecting the circuit for any visible signs of damage, checking for loose connections, and testing appliances for defects. Once the cause is determined, appropriate measures must be taken to rectify the issue.
One way to safely fix an electrical short is by repairing or replacing damaged wires or cables. It is essential to turn off the power and ensure proper insulation and protection of the wiring before attempting any repairs. Additionally, using electrical tape or wire connectors can help secure loose connections and prevent further short-circuiting.
Another option is to redistribute electrical loads to prevent overloading circuits. This can be achieved by unplugging unnecessary appliances, spreading out the usage of high-demand devices, or installing dedicated circuits for power-hungry equipment.
In more complex cases, seeking professional help from a qualified electrician is paramount. They possess the expertise and knowledge to safely diagnose and fix electrical shorts, ensuring long-term safety and minimizing the risk of future incidents.
To prevent electrical shorts from occurring, regular maintenance and inspections of electrical systems are vital. This includes checking for any signs of wear and tear, monitoring the load capacity of circuits, and using surge protectors to safeguard sensitive electronics.
